Console Box: Removal

CAUTION: Before handling the airbag system components, refer to "CAUTION" of "General Description" in "AIRBAG SYSTEM". <Ref. to CAUTION , General Description.>
  1. Disconnect the ground terminal from the battery sensor, and wait for at least 60 seconds before starting work. <Ref. to BATTERY , NOTE, Repair Contents.>
    NOTE:
    • On CVT models, shift the select lever into "N" before disconnecting the battery ground cable.
    • On power seat models, move the front seat all the way forward before disconnecting the battery ground cable.
  2. Release the clips, and remove the ornament panel - console.

  3. Remove the cover assembly - front.
    1. Remove the shift knob. (MT model)
    2. Pull up the cover assembly - front, and release the clips.
    3. Disconnect the connectors, and remove the cover assembly - front.

  4. Remove the console box assembly.
    1. Remove the caps, and remove the bolts.
    2. Remove the screws, disconnect the harness connector and remove the console box assembly.

  5. Remove the left and right panel center LWR.
    1. Remove the screws and clips.
    2. Release the claws, and then pull the panel center LWR to remove.
